What the accuracy spec means on the bench

The LM70CIMMX-5/NOPB is a digital local temperature sensor from Texas Instruments, outputting a 10-bit temperature reading over an SPI interface. The headline accuracy is ±1.5°C across the -10°C to 65°C test range, widening to -2°C / +3°C at the extremes — that ±1.5°C band is tight enough for board-level thermal monitoring where you need to catch a 5°C drift before the part derates, but not tight enough for a precision oven reference.

Housed in an 8-VSSOP (also listed as 8-TSSOP / 8-MSOP, 0.118-inch width, 3.00 mm wide), the package is a standard fine-pitch small outline. The surface-mount footprint is shared across the LM70 family, so a layout done for the LM70CIMM-5/NOPB accepts this variant without a board spin. The shutdown mode feature drops the quiescent current for battery or power-sensitive designs — the SPI bus stays tri-stated so the line doesn't conflict with other devices on the same bus.
